Flight Attendant Students Pose Topless for Breast Cancer

Following the tragic death of 33 year old singer Yao Beina this week, several student air stewardesses paid homage to the singer by posing topless to raise awareness of breast cancer.

The students of Chengdu Aviation Academy posed with posters of the singer who passed away on Friday called for women to take care of their health and be aware of cancer.

They held banners calling women to cherish their breasts and for more attention to be paid to women’s health.

One of the participants, Ao Min said “We are a little shy, but we want to use our bodies to say to you, a healthy body is a beautiful body. We hope more women can pay more attention their own bodies and take care of their health, as well as being aware of breast cancer.”
